Страница 6 из 7

СообщениеДобавлено: Чт мар 28, 2019 2:16 pm
galavarez
Сегодня наконец принесли принтер с дюплексам brother 2560.
Поигрался с настройками дюплекса и пришел к мнению, что печать тестовых листов для дюпликса должна быть четная, т.е. 1 тест лист на 2 стороны бумаги. На бразере потестил немного вроде все работает. Даже работает ручная и авто подача =) Лоток 1 и 2 не проверял.
Проверяйте и отписывайтесь о результатах brrr


Версия 2.4.12
- Подправил работу с дюплексом

СообщениеДобавлено: Чт апр 18, 2019 2:21 pm
oldman_lbt
добрый день.
Возможно ли сделать в программе опцию (скрытую вообще), чтобы она запоминала
размеры окна и открывалась потом в таком же состоянии.
Мне удобно когда в окне программа работает, а не на весь экран, но вот
настройки окна заданы в свойствах ярлыка на рабочем столе, и окно узкое, не все листы пробные влазят, надо
скроллить постоянно

СообщениеДобавлено: Чт апр 18, 2019 2:53 pm
galavarez
oldman_lbt писал(а):добрый день.
Возможно ли сделать в программе опцию (скрытую вообще), чтобы она запоминала
размеры окна и открывалась потом в таком же состоянии.
Мне удобно когда в окне программа работает, а не на весь экран, но вот
настройки окна заданы в свойствах ярлыка на рабочем столе, и окно узкое, не все листы пробные влазят, надо
скроллить постоянно


Надо подумать как сохранять настройки и потом их загружать при запуске программы. В голову приходится только ini файлы.
Как вариант удалить не нужные тестовые листы из папки files, тогда скролить не придется.

СообщениеДобавлено: Ср апр 24, 2019 11:00 am
oldman_lbt
с .ini пропадет ее мобильность и безмусорность...
а может она .ini создавать в папке типа Temp или подобной
виндовой, чтобы оттуда не удалялась пользователем случайно
и настройки всегда были.

СообщениеДобавлено: Вт апр 30, 2019 11:31 am
Konti
Добрый день. Нашёл ещё баг: сначала печатал через дуплекс, потом запустил один односторонний лист через кнопку "печать без диалога" и принтер опять отправил через дуплекс, причём первая сторона пустая, на второй изо.
И ещё заметил что прокрутка тестовых листов не всегда работает - надо щёлкнуть мышкой между листов чтобы заработала. В идеале хотелось бы чтобы прокрутка листов и количества копий работала когда курсор над областью, без лишний движений ))
Всем приятных майских выходных :dr_ink:

СообщениеДобавлено: Вт апр 30, 2019 11:49 am
oldman_lbt
по поводу прокрутки - есть такое дело, но вопрос в том, реализуется ли такая команда "фокус"
на языке в этом приложении...

СообщениеДобавлено: Вт апр 30, 2019 3:19 pm
galavarez
Konti писал(а):Добрый день. Нашёл ещё баг: сначала печатал через дуплекс, потом запустил один односторонний лист через кнопку "печать без диалога" и принтер опять отправил через дуплекс, причём первая сторона пустая, на второй изо.
И ещё заметил что прокрутка тестовых листов не всегда работает - надо щёлкнуть мышкой между листов чтобы заработала. В идеале хотелось бы чтобы прокрутка листов и количества копий работала когда курсор над областью, без лишний движений ))
Всем приятных майских выходных :dr_ink:


С дюплексом как всегда все тяжело =), как будет принтер с ним, попробую устранить баг.
Прокрутка листов теперь работает без клика, а вот выбор копий придется кликать, на них авто фокуса в делфи нет.


oldman_lbt писал(а):с .ini пропадет ее мобильность и безмусорность...
а может она .ini создавать в папке типа Temp или подобной
виндовой, чтобы оттуда не удалялась пользователем случайно
и настройки всегда были.


Сделал внешние настройки в ini файле. Лежат рядом с exe.
Кому он нужен оставляйте и редактируйте как надо. Там выставляется высота, ширина и положение окна.
Редактируется ручками в блокноте. Если ini файл удалить то программа по умолчанию будет в центре экрана, как обычно. А если оставить то будет считывать данные с него.

Версия 2.4.13
- Добавил: Фокус на тестовых листах без клика
- Добавил: Ini файл для настройки окна программы

СообщениеДобавлено: Чт май 02, 2019 1:10 pm
oldman_lbt
возник маленький вопрос: по какому принципу программа без .ini файла запускалась в определенном
по размеру окне? может этот момент можно как-то порешать, и никакой .ini не нужен будет?

СообщениеДобавлено: Чт май 02, 2019 2:14 pm
galavarez
oldman_lbt писал(а):возник маленький вопрос: по какому принципу программа без .ini файла запускалась в определенном
по размеру окне? может этот момент можно как-то порешать, и никакой .ini не нужен будет?


Когда делаешь gui в редакторе, то выставляешь размер окна по умолчанию, у меня вроде это 1000 на 500, а так же включил положение окна программы по центру монитора. Это все когда нет ini.
Потом дописал если ini файл есть, то отключается положение экрана по центру и берутся данные из файла (высота, ширина, x, y).

Щас подумал что все эти настройки можно сохранять в реестре и менять их на лету, без ini файлов.

Версия 2.4.14
- Изменил: Настройки окна программы сохраняются в реестре а не в ini файле

СообщениеДобавлено: Вс май 12, 2019 12:44 pm
oldman_lbt
вот сразу косячок: при увеличении размера окна - не меняется размер окна с тестовыми листами.
там остается пустота в общем окне, а тестовые листы при этом все не влазят.
https://yadi.sk/i/1qoIkuoX3mEw7A

СообщениеДобавлено: Вс май 19, 2019 3:49 pm
galavarez
oldman_lbt писал(а):вот сразу косячок: при увеличении размера окна - не меняется размер окна с тестовыми листами.
там остается пустота в общем окне, а тестовые листы при этом все не влазят.
https://yadi.sk/i/1qoIkuoX3mEw7A



Вроде как исправил глюк, на работе нет моника с разрешением 1920x1080. Пришлось дома ставить делфи и настраивать, по этому долго все делал =)


Версия 2.4.15
- Изменил: Устранил глюк окна при разрешении 1920×1080 и выше

СообщениеДобавлено: Вт май 21, 2019 7:29 am
oldman_lbt
Супер. Спасибо

СообщениеДобавлено: Чт июн 13, 2019 6:04 pm
dviz
Я тут, эта.. скачал программку, а она чо-то не работает.. Не показывает тестовые листы.
Может ей библиотеки какие нужны или ещё чо-нить?
3547

СообщениеДобавлено: Пт июн 14, 2019 8:59 am
Konti
Теперь новые версии идут без папки "files", в ней хранятся тестовые. Прога видит изо только в формате .bmp
upd: ссылка на тесты в первом посте

СообщениеДобавлено: Пт июн 14, 2019 1:07 pm
Mohnatiy
Автору низкий поклон за эту прогу!
Ремонтирую принтеры, в день от 5-ти штук и до "заката". Когда случайно увидел эту прогу то глазам не мог поверить! НАКОНЕЦ!!!

Что хотелось бы добавить, частенько приходится "нагружать" принтер на тестировке. 300-500 листов за раз. Поэтому можно ли как-то добавить десятки и сотни в количестве копий? Может отдельно готовые кнопки или возле стрелок добавочные в виде двойной стрелки?